Inspection Deficiencies
Health inspections identify violations of federal standards. Severity ranges from no actual harm (A–F) to immediate jeopardy (J–L).
Most recent inspection (July 31, 2025)
Provide rooms that are at least 80 square feet per resident in multiple rooms and 100 square feet for single resident rooms.
Environmental Deficiencies — Deficient, Provider has date of correction, corrected September 4, 2025
Protect each resident from all types of abuse such as physical, mental, sexual abuse, physical punishment, and neglect by anybody.
Freedom from Abuse, Neglect, and Exploitation Deficiencies — Deficient, Provider has date of correction, corrected July 23, 2025
Timely report suspected abuse, neglect, or theft and report the results of the investigation to proper authorities.
Freedom from Abuse, Neglect, and Exploitation Deficiencies — Deficient, Provider has date of correction, corrected September 4, 2025
Ensure nurse aides have the skills they need to care for residents, and give nurse aides education in dementia care and abuse prevention.
Nursing and Physician Services Deficiencies — Deficient, Provider has date of correction, corrected September 4, 2025
Ensure drugs and biologicals used in the facility are labeled in accordance with currently accepted professional principles; and all drugs and biologicals must be stored in locked compartments, separately locked, compartments for controlled drugs.
Pharmacy Service Deficiencies — Deficient, Provider has date of correction, corrected January 26, 2026
Ensure that residents are free from significant medication errors.
Pharmacy Service Deficiencies — Deficient, Provider has date of correction, corrected July 23, 2025
Ensure that a nursing home area is free from accident hazards and provides adequate supervision to prevent accidents.
Quality of Life and Care Deficiencies — Deficient, Provider has date of correction, corrected January 26, 2026
Provide appropriate pressure ulcer care and prevent new ulcers from developing.
Quality of Life and Care Deficiencies — Deficient, Provider has date of correction, corrected September 4, 2025
Ensure that a nursing home area is free from accident hazards and provides adequate supervision to prevent accidents.
Quality of Life and Care Deficiencies — Deficient, Provider has date of correction, corrected September 4, 2025
Ensure each resident must receive and the facility must provide necessary behavioral health care and services.
Quality of Life and Care Deficiencies — Deficient, Provider has date of correction, corrected September 4, 2025
Safeguard resident-identifiable information and/or maintain medical records on each resident that are in accordance with accepted professional standards.
Resident Assessment and Care Planning Deficiencies — Deficient, Provider has date of correction, corrected September 4, 2025
